- Title
<sup>57</sup>Fe and <sup>151</sup>Eu Mössbauer studies of magnetoresistive Europium based cobalt perovskites.

- Abstract
Eu0.8Sr0.2Fe x Co1− x O3− z CMR perovskites with different iron concentrations ( x = 0, 0.025, 0.075, 0.15, 0.3) were investigated by X-ray diffraction, AC magnetic susceptibility, magnetotransport, as well as 57Fe and 151Eu Mössbauer spectrometry. The valence state of europium ions was found to be trivalent, independently of the iron concentration. 57Fe Mössbauer spectra and magnetic susceptibility of the investigated perovskites presented complementary results for the magnetic transitions.
